Honda CD175 (1976)
The Honda CD 175 1976 model is a motorcycle featuring a four-stroke, twin-cylinder engine with a capacity of 174cc/10.6 cu-in. The motorcycle has a carburetor induction system and a CDI ignition for starting, which can be done by both electric and kick methods. The maximum power output is 17 hp/12.4 kW at 9000 rpm, but the maximum torque was not stated. The wet multi-plate clutch has four-speed transmission that drives the bike, which is equipped with final drive chains. The open diamond frame with a stressed engine accommodates the motorcycle with oil-dampened telescopic front suspension of 115mm wheel travel and twin shock, oil-dampened rear suspension at a wheel travel of 64mm. The braking system is composed of a 140mm drum brake for the front and a 130mm drum brake for the rear. The front and rear tires are 2.75-17 and 3.00-17, respectively, and the seat height is 744mm/29.3 inches. The dry weight of the bike is 122kg/269 lbs, and the fuel capacity is 10.5 liters/2.8 US gallons.
